  • Own initial and ongoing store allocations, ensuring optimal distribution of inventory across all channels
  • Execute allocation strategies that support seasonal launches, new product introductions, and in-season performance
  • Balance inventory across stores, distribution centers (CA & US), and channels including e-commerce, Amazon, and wholesale
  • Monitor sales performance, sell-through, and inventory levels to make timely reallocation and transfer recommendations for stores
  • Partner with Merchandising, Planning, and Replenishment to align allocations with assortment and demand forecasts
  • Identify and act on opportunities to improve in-stock performance, reduce excess inventory, and optimize size and SKU distribution
  • Maintain allocation systems, tools, and reporting to ensure accuracy, speed, and consistency
  • Provide clear reporting and insights on inventory movement, store performance, and allocation effectiveness
  • Previous experience in retail allocation, merchandising, planning, or inventory management
  • Strong understanding of retail math and key metrics (sell-through, in-stock, WOS, inventory turn, GM)
